Experiment: E89-038 CLAS experiment, 1999

Spokespersons: V. Burkert, R. Minehart

Experiment comment: Beam energy 1.515 GeV. Global 5.8% scaling systematic uncertainty for all data points

Measurement comment: Global 5.8% scaling systematic uncertainty

Publication:

Quantity measured: dσ/dΩ, mcbn/sterad
Differential cross section.
Beam: e, polarization: none
Target: p (Z=1, A=1), polarization: none
Final state: π+n, polarization: none

Q2 : 0.25 — 0.35 GeV2
W : 1.5 — 1.52 GeV
Ebeam : 1.515 GeV
